Q: Is 102,430,211 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 102,430,211 is a composite number.

Why is 102,430,211 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 102,430,211 can be evenly divided by 1 13 7,879,247 and 102,430,211, with no remainder.

Since 102,430,211 cannot be divided by just 1 and 102,430,211, it is a composite number.
